It's funny because there's so much truth in what Siobhan is telling Liz. Yes, she's stalking her in their confrontations but at it's core it's the fact that Siobhan has her number. She sees that Liz has always been content to play the victim and rely on men than take control of her life. And if it's not Lucky then Jason as evidenced by her literally rushing into his arms to be comforted. And before that she's was waffling between "loving" both Lucky and Nicholas in her cheating. In order to deflect blame off herself, she tried to put the affair on Nicholas and accuse him of chasing her. Thankfully Nicholas called her on it.

And even though Siobhan wasn't there to witness Lucky's addiction as Liz pointed out, she knows it's a stupid idea to have Lucky investigating the case because... it's stupid idea! The fact that Liz thinks she's the one who really knows Lucky and knows he wont be tempted to use when their scenes were interspersed with him fingering the bottle of pills like a true crack addict for the entire episode spoke volumes. Siobhan is right.

Steve has been telling her for months she isn't ready to return to work but she would rather weep in hallways, mess up patients charts and have public breakdowns because her box o' pain is so overwhelming than do the right thing and seek professional help.

Helena said it best... "The girl wears desperation like she wears perfume". Best line of the day.

And they now have Monica telling her don't let her selfishness ruin her other children's lives which is surprising because multiple characters are now calling her on her crap.
